WebbStarch is mostly composed of amylopectin and amylose, but amylopectin has been shown to degrade more easily. The reason is most likely because amylopectin is highly branched and these branches are more available to digestive enzymes. In contrast, amylose tends to form helices and contain hydrogen bonding. While amylose was thought to be completely unbranched, it is now known that some of its molecules contain a few branch points. Amylose is a much smaller molecule than amylopectin. About one quarter of the mass of stored starch in plants consist of amylose, although there are about 150 times more amylose than amylopectin molecules. Webb13 maj 2024 · Mung bean starch granules presented round or kidney shapes with the diameter between 5 and 30 µm ( Figure 1 A 1 ). Native starch granules were observed having smooth surfaces, and shallow grooves appeared on the surfaces of most of the granules ( Figure 1 A 1 ).
